Edward Robinson was born in 1751 in West Bromwich, Staffordshire, England, United Kingdom, the child of Joseph Rabbisson And Mary Bloomer. Edward Robinson married Susanah Hadley, and had children including Amelia Robinson, Ann Robinson, Edward Robinson, Elizabeth Robinson, Joseph Robinson, Philemon Robinson. Edward Robinson passed away in 1810 in W.bromwich, Staffs, England.
